๐ Consumer Credit (Western Australia) Amendment Bill 1999
Assented toLABill 5828 October 1999
The Consumer Credit (Western Australia) Amendment Bill 1999 amends the Consumer Credit (Western Australia) Act 1996 to modify the Consumer Credit (Western Australia) Code. Key changes relate to the definition of 'amount of credit', contract requirements, and payment crediting.
Impact
Credit providers and consumers in Western Australia are affected. The changes clarify aspects of credit contracts, potentially affecting how credit is offered and managed.
Key Changes
["Modifies the definition of 'amount of credit' to exclude certain interest and fees.", "Changes requirements for written contract documents and acceptance of offers.", "Amends rules regarding the crediting of payments under credit contracts.", "Modifies disclosure requirements related to insurance."]
Parliamentary Progress
- LA IntroducedLA28 Oct 1999
- LA Second Reading MovedLA28 Oct 1999
- LA AmendedLA22 Mar 2000
- LA Consideration in DetailLA22 Mar 2000
- LA Second Reading AgreedLA22 Mar 2000
- LA Third ReadingLA23 Mar 2000
- LC Second Reading MovedLC28 Mar 2000
- LC Second Reading AgreedLC30 May 2000
- LC Third ReadingLC30 May 2000
